The Heyfield Museum suffered damaged to our roof during recent storms. A quote to carry out repairs came to nearly $6500. We have been very fortunate to have received a donation of $5000 towards the repairs from the committees of the Heyfield Timber Festival / Heyfield Lumberjacks B&S ball. Many thanks for your wonderful contribution which will keep our building water tight and secure.
Other sections of our roof will need repairs in the future but one project at a time...

We had a wonderful group through today from the Giffard CWA. Initially some of there group were confused and met at the Heyfield Timbers Workers Hall of fame down in McFarlane Street as they thought we had closed and that was now the museum.

So, no we haven't closed or moved we're still here proud and strong and looking forward to having you or your group come visit.

Just a reminder of our opening hours - every Saturday 10am to Midday or by appointment. Located at 7 Temple Street Heyfield (The former historic Heyfield Post Ofice)
